Chief Fiduciary Officer

Peggy came storming into her role at National Advisors. Literally. In fact, her start date coincided with Hurricane Harvey making landfall in Houston in 2017. Under her deft leadership, NAT was able to build a Houston, Texas satellite office that was home to eight employees supporting some of our most strategic client relationships. While the Houston office has since closed, Peggy has continued as CFO and has helped grow our fiduciary department to include seven JDs and five CFTAs.

“I began my career as an estate planning attorney in New Jersey, drafting estate plans and trust documents. Since then, I have focused on the trust business, taking on roles as a trust officer, senior trust officer, trust sales associate and now CFO. I lean on this breadth of experience and how it allows me to take a holistic approach to my business decisions.”

With a double-major BA degree from Barry University in Miami (Philosophy and Pre-Law Studies) and a JD from Stetson University College of Law in Tampa, Peggy is more than qualified to work within the confines and nuances of all fiduciary duties at NATC and brings to bear the insights of a Bar membership in both New Jersey and Texas.

Married with four kids and a beloved golden retriever, Peggy is a board member of her local PTO and actively involved in the Girl Scouts of San Jacinto Council, where she serves as Troop Leader and is a former Gold Award recipient – the highest level of achievement within the GSA.
